  • Year Group Focus - Reception

    Fri 19 Apr 2024

     In Reception we have started our brand new topic, Ready Steady Grow beginning with our Talk Through Story of The Gigantic Turnip which the children linked back to our previous learning of The Enormous  Turnip. It has been wonderful to see the children able to remember the key vocabulary and favourite phrases from the story. In our topic lessons so far we have been learning about where food comes from and using our senses to describe different fruits and vegetables – this was very popular and the children loved trying the different foods. 

     

    In our daily phonics lessons we are working hard to continue to learn new sounds and orally blend words. This is something that can be done at home. We use Fred talk to sound out a word e.g. c-a-t. We are   getting ready to transition into year 1 so are developing our sentence writing and trying to remember to use capital letters, finger spaces and full stops.

     

    In our provision, the children have also been extending their learning by, for example, finding ways to pull and heave, and tug and yank tyres and large boxes across the playground which develops gross motor skills – we saw some lovely partnerships, fantastic communication and wonderful problem solving skills.

     

     

     

     

     

     

     

     

    Our maths work this half term has continued to develop counting to 10 and then 20 and beyond. We have been using different objects to count with and practised strategies different ways that we can make this easier (putting the objects in a line) we have also develop strategies with how to count when objects    cannot be moved. The classed decided it would be best to cross them out as they were counting them. We can’t wait to see what else they learn to do next!
